55. Clean and inspect the oil filter adapter.
zFlush the adapter with parts cleaner. If metal particles are present, install a new oil filter
adapter.
56. Remove the bolts and the oil pump screen and pickup tube.
57. Remove the oil pump screen and pickup tube spacer.

63.
CAUTION: Do not scratch the cylinder walls or crankshaft journals with the
connecting rod.
NOTE: Before removing pistons, inspect the top of the cylinder bores. If necessary, remove the
ridge or carbon deposits from each cylinder using a cylinder ridge reamer following
manufacturer's instructions.
Using the special tool, push pistons number 1 and 6 through the top of the cylinder block.
64. To remove pistons 3 and 5, 4 and 7, 2 and 8, turn crankshaft 90 degrees and repeat the previous two steps.

10.
CAUTION: Make sure the tool is seated correctly on the valve spring. Apply a small
amount of air at a time. This will prevent the tool from shifting and causing damage to
the cylinder head.
Install the air- operated spring compressor on the cylinder head.
11. Compress the valve spring compressor and remove the key from the valves.
12. Remove the intake valves and the valve springs. 1. Release the pressure and remove the valve spring compressor. 2. Remove the intake valves and the valve springs from the cylinder head. Klj . 4 ba
